pretty boys

Definition of pretty boysnext
plural of pretty boy
1
as in dudes
a man extremely interested in his clothing and personal appearance a downtown dance club with lots of pretty boys in attendance

2
as in studs
a physically attractive man as a musical performer, he has yet to prove that he's more than just another pretty boy
